#390364 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#390364 is composed of 22.4% red, 1.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 273.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 20.2%. #390364 color hex could be obtained by blending #7206c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#390364 color description : Very dark violet.

#390364 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#390364 has RGB values of R:57, G:3,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 3736420.

Shades and Tints of #390364

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f1ff is the lightest one.
